Tax Compliance: Transfer Pricing Regulation and Enforcement

November 14

Gain the tools and knowledge necessary to navigate the complexities of transfer pricing, ensuring your company remains compliant.

This presentation will deepen your understanding of key concepts such as the arm’s length principle and various transfer pricing methods, help you learn how to properly document intercompany transactions, and gain insights into common pitfalls and best practices, reducing the risk of non-compliance and potential disputes with tax authorities. Attendees will also benefit from real-world case studies and examples that illustrate how to handle transfer pricing issues effectively.

Learning Objectives

  • You will be able to explain transfer pricing principles and their importance in tax compliance.
  • You will be able to discuss global transfer pricing regulations and recent changes in the law.
  • You will be able to review best practices for documentation and maintaining compliance to avoid common pitfalls.
  • You will be able to describe how transfer pricing is enforced and the potential penalties for non-compliance.

Agenda

Introduction
  • Welcome and Objectives: Brief Introduction and Outline the Objectives of the Presentation
  • Overview of Transfer Pricing: High-Level Overview of Transfer Pricing and Why It Matters in Tax Compliance
Basics of Transfer Pricing
  • Key Concepts: Fundamental Concepts of Transfer Pricing
  • Regulatory Framework: Key Regulations and Guidelines Governing Transfer Pricing, Including OECD Guidelines and Local Regulations
Transfer Pricing Documentation
  • Documentation Requirements: Documentation Requirements, Including Master File, Local File/Local Transfer Pricing Report, and Country-By-Country Reporting
  • Best Practices: Best Practices for Preparing and Maintaining Transfer Pricing Documentation to Ensure Compliance
Enforcement and Penalties
  • Enforcement: Discuss the IRS’s/Other Tax Authorities’ Approach to Transfer Pricing Enforcement
  • Penalties: Potential Penalties for Non-Compliance
  • Additional Penalty Mitigation Techniques: Advance Pricing Agreements and Mutual Agreement Procedures
Recent Developments
  • Pillar 1 Amount B
  • Pillar 2 Transfer Pricing Implications
  • Cases Studies
  • Overturn of Chevron Deference and Impact on Transfer Pricing Enforcement
Qa & A Conclusions
  • Question and Answers
  • Summary and Key Takeaways
